Output 614042153ec8cd69e98362a17e03ddcadab24a5acea1675c11c3f560427946b7:1

value
34423480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8076444fcbf6d0867a2da376ddd838b33511b0 OP_EQUAL
address
3Jh9VvFwMLwq5u6YudN9gLTsMdNT2SSVk3
transaction
614042153ec8cd69e98362a17e03ddcadab24a5acea1675c11c3f560427946b7
spent
true